South Dakota Code § 47-1A-831.2

Limitations on the effect of §§

47-1A-831
and
47-1A-831.1
.
Nothing contained in §§
47-1A-831
and
47-1A-831.1
:
(1) In any instance where fairness is at issue, such as consideration of the fairness of a transaction to the corporation under subdivision
47-1A-861.1
(3), alters the burden of proving the fact or lack of fairness otherwise applicable;
(2) Alters the fact or lack of liability of a director under another section of this chapter, such as the provisions governing the consequences of an unlawful distribution under §§
47-1A-833
and
47-1A-833.1
, or a transactional interest under §§
47-1A-861
and
47-1A-861.1
; or
(3) Affects any rights to which the corporation or a shareholder may be entitled under another statute of this state or the United States.
